Laurie is moving a dresser with a mass of 250 kg. She does 126 J of work with a force of 14 N. How far does she move the dresser

?
.5 m
112 m
124 m
9 m

The main formula is E = sum Work, 
or the work is W= FxAB=E
so AB= E/F = 126/ 14 = 9m
